Understand Light Sources
Before diving into shading, grasp the concept of light sources. Determine where your light is coming from and visualize how it interacts with objects in your drawing. This awareness will guide your shading decisions, creating accurate and also convincing results.
Grasp Basic Shading Techniques
Familiarize yourself with fundamental shading techniques such as hatching, cross-hatching, stippling, and blending. Each technique offers a distinct texture and appearance, allowing you to experiment and also find the one that best suits your style.
Start with Light Layers
Begin with light shading layers and gradually build up the darkness. This incremental approach gives you better control over the shading intensity, preventing over-darkening and ensuring a smooth transition between light and also shadow.
Study Real-life References
Observation is key. Study real-life objects, photographs, and scenes to understand how light interacts with various surfaces. This practice enhances your ability to replicate realistic shading in your drawings.
Utilize Different Pencil Grades
Experiment with pencils of varying grades (from 9H to 9B) to achieve a wide range of shading effects. Hard pencils produce lighter shades, while soft ones create darker tones. Combining different grades can result in nuanced and also dynamic shading.
Embrace Contrast

Pay Attention to Edges
Soft edges create a sense of depth, while hard edges bring objects to the forefront. Intentionally manipulating edge sharpness enhances the realism of your drawings. Use soft edges for distant objects and also hard edges for closer elements.
Experiment with Textures
Different surfaces possess unique textures that affect how they’re shaded. Whether it’s the roughness of a stone or the smoothness of glass, practicing diverse texturing techniques can add authenticity to your work.
Master Perspective
Shading plays a crucial role in depicting perspective. Objects closer to the viewer are darker and have more defined shadows, while those farther away appear lighter with softer shadows. Understanding this principle enhances the spatial quality of your drawings.
Use Reference Grids
For complex subjects, employ reference grids to ensure accurate proportions and shading placement. This technique helps you break down the drawing into manageable sections, making shading less daunting.
